Overview of 161 East 91st Street

161 East 91st Street was built in 1941 and converted to co-op apartments in 1989. 161 East 91st Street has a total of 47 apartments and is located in Carnegie Hill, very close to the 6 subway line.

During the past two years, 5 apartments have sold: the most expensive was a three bedroom that sold for $1,700,000, and the least expensive was a one bedroom that sold for $500,000.

Amenities at this pet friendly building include bike room, resident storage, washer/dryer in building and live-in superintendent.

Why are we displaying the estimated price per room?

For some co-ops, instead of price per square foot, we use an estimate of the number of rooms for each sold apartment to chart price changes over time. This is because many co-op listings do not include square footage information, and this makes it challenging to calculate accurate square-foot averages.

By displaying the price per estimated room count, we are able to provide a more reliable and consistent metric for comparing sales in the building. While we hope that this gives you a clearer sense of price trends in the building, all data should be independently verified.
